$7000 is a good trade in price. Car lots don't/can't give you retail value for your car. They have to make money on it when they sell it. Trading a car in is a compromise between the car's value and getting rid of it quickly.
Of course holding out for top dollar always seems smarter, but how long can you wait? Sometimes you just need to trade in and move on. So basically its up to you and your situation.
